Inclusion Criteria
|
| Age From |
20.00 Year(s) |
| Age To |
60.00 Year(s) |
| Gender |
Both |
| Details |
1) Subjects of either sex, between the age of 20 and 60 years
2) Presence of at least 20 natural teeth
3) Individuals with healthy periodontium of clinical parameters of bleeding on probing less than 10 % and probing depth less than or equal to 3 mm
4) Patients with diagnosis of generalised stage III grade B periodontitis with clinical parameters of probing depth more than or equal to 6 mm and clinical attachment loss more than or equal to 5 mm
5) Subjects with obesity having BMI values given by Asia Pacific Perspective Obesity - WHO 2000
Non obese - between range of 18.5 to 22.9 kg/m2
Obese - between range of 25 to 29.9 kg/m2 |
|
| ExclusionCriteria |
| Details |
1) Individuals with systemic diseases
2) Smokers
3) Pregnant/lactating and postmenopausal women
4) Individuals who have received periodontal therapy in the last 6 months
5) Individuals who have history of antimicrobial and anti-inflammatory therapy in the past 6 months |

Brief Summary
|
This study is an observational study assesing the levels of Galectin-3 and Tumor necrosis factor alpha in GCF of periodontitis patients with and without obesity . It will be conducted in The Oxford Dental College , Bangalore in India . The primary outcome measure will be Galectin-3 and TNF alpha levels in GCF . The secondary outcome measure will be clinical parameters - Gingival index, bleeding on probing, probing depth and clinical attachment loss . 36 GCF sample is taken from 12 subjects in each group and biomarker levels will be assessed using ELISA method . |
